FS for Mellanox Compatible 400G QSFP-DD to 2x200G QSFP56 AOC Cable(7-meter, QSFP-DD to QSFP56)

The FS for Mellanox Compatible 400G QSFP-DD to 2x200G QSFP56 breakout Active Optical Cable operates over Multi-Mode Fiber (MMF). This breakout cable is compliant with IEEE 802.3, QSFP-DD MSA, SFF-8024, SFF-8679, SFF-8665, OIF-CEI-04.0 and CMIS 4.0. The built-in digital diagnostics monitoring (DDM) allows access to real-time operating parameters.
It provides connectivity between system units with a 400GbE connector on one side and two separate 200GbE connectors on the other side and is suitable for Data Center Appications.

Specifications
Part Number
QDD-2Q56AO07
Vendor Name
FS
Form Factor
QSFP-DD to 2x QSFP56
Max Data Rate
425Gbps(8x53.125Gb/s)
Cable Length
7m (23ft)
Cable Type
OM3
Wavelength
850nm
Minimum Bend Radius
30mm
Transmitter Type
VSCEL
Receiver Type
PD
Power Consumption
≤11W
Jacket Material
LSZH
CDR (Clock and Data Recovery)
TX & RX Built-in CDR
Modulation Format
8x 50G-PAM4 to Dual 4x 50G-PAM4
Commercial Temperature Range
0 to 70°C (32 to 158°F)
Protocols
IEEE 802.3cd, IEEE 802.3bs, QSFP-DD MSA, SFF-8024, SFF-8679, SFF-8665, CMIS 4.0, OIF-CEI-04.0
